Charging Port / DC Jack Repair

A loose or broken charging port is a common issue, especially on laptops that get moved around a lot. The DC jack can crack, come loose from the motherboard, or develop a faulty connection. We perform both board-level DC jack repairs (resoldering) and full port replacements. Pricing ranges from R450 to R900.

Motherboard Repair

Motherboard failure is the most complex laptop repair, but it's often fixable at component level. Common motherboard problems include no power, random shutdowns, no display output, USB ports not working, and charging circuit failure. Many of these are caused by load shedding surges, liquid spills, or age-related capacitor failure. We diagnose at component level and replace the specific failed parts rather than the entire motherboard, saving you thousands. Motherboard repair ranges from R1,200 to R3,500.

Hinge Repair

Broken laptop hinges are extremely common, especially on HP and Acer models where the hinge design is a known weak point. We repair hinges by reinforcing the mounting points, replacing the hinge mechanism, and in some cases fabricating custom brackets when original parts aren't available. Hinge repair costs between R600 and R1,500.

Fan Replacement & Overheating

If your laptop is running hot, making grinding noises, or shutting down during intensive tasks, the cooling system needs attention. We replace faulty fans, clean out dust buildup, reapply thermal paste, and ensure proper airflow. This extends the life of your laptop significantly and prevents heat damage to the CPU and GPU. Fan service starts from R500.
